Job Overview
TLC Nursing Associates, Inc. is seeking an experienced Registered Nurse (RN) – PICU to provide specialized critical care for infants, children, and adolescents in the Pediatric Intensive Care Unit. This role involves assessing critically ill pediatric patients, administering life-saving interventions, and collaborating with a multidisciplinary team to ensure the best patient outcomes.
Responsibilities
- Provide comprehensive critical care to pediatric patients with life-threatening conditions
- Monitor and assess vital signs, ventilators, and IV drips
- Administer medications, fluids, and blood products following PICU protocols
- Respond to medical emergencies, including respiratory distress and cardiac arrests
- Work closely with pediatric intensivists, respiratory therapists, and specialists to manage patient care
- Educate and support patients' families through critical care situations
- Maintain strict infection control and patient safety procedures
- Document patient conditions, treatments, and responses accurately
- Participate in continuous learning, training, and quality improvement initiatives
Qualifications
- Active Registered Nurse (RN) license in applicable state(s)
- Minimum 2 years of PICU, NICU, or pediatric critical care experience
- Certification in Basic Life Support (BLS) and Pediatric Advanced Life Support (PALS) required
- Critical Care Registered Nurse – Pediatric (CCRN-P) preferred but not required
- Experience with ventilators, ECMO, and pediatric sedation preferred
- Strong communication and family-centered care approach
